def _autoResolve(self, thing): """(internal) """ preposition = thing.autoverbs[self._verb] verb = thing.getVerb(self._verb, preposition) if verb: self.candidates.append((verb, thing, preposition))
def _resolve(self, thing, preposition): """(internal) """ if not (thing in map(lambda z: z[1], self.candidates)): verb = thing.getVerb(self._verb, preposition) if verb: self.candidates.append((verb, thing, None))
def _resolve(self, thing, preposition): """(internal) """ if not (thing in map (lambda z: z[1], self.candidates)): verb = thing.getVerb(self._verb, preposition) if verb: self.candidates.append((verb, thing, None))